M. H. Siegel (PSU) and N. J. Klingler (GSFC/UMBC/CRESSTII)
report on behalf of the Swift/UVOT team:

The Swift/UVOT began settled observations of the field of GRB 250702F 97 s after the BAT trigger (Klingler et al., GCN Circ. 40894). A source consistent with the XRT position (Goad et al., GCN Circ. 40902) is detected in the initial UVOT exposures. The source is detected in all filters except for uvw2 and only marginally in uvm2, which would be consistent with the redshift reported by de Ugarte Postigo et al. (GCN Circ. 40901).

The preliminary UVOT position is:
    RA  (J2000) =  14:11:44.66 = 212.93610 (deg.)
    Dec (J2000) = +16:44:55.1  =  16.74863 (deg.)
with an estimated uncertainty of 0.42 arc sec. (radius, 90% confidence).

Preliminary detections and 3-sigma upper limits using the UVOT photometric system
(Breeveld et al. 2011, AIP Conf. Proc. 1358, 373) for the early exposures are: 

Filter         T_start(s)   T_stop(s)      Exp(s)           Mag

white               97          247          147         15.86 +/- 0.02
v                 5904         6104          197         18.39 +/- 0.14
b                 3878         4077          197         18.42 +/- 0.09
u                  309          515          202         15.04 +/- 0.03
m2                9609        10131          514         19.53 +/- 0.24
w2                5699         5899          197        >19.2

The magnitudes in the table are not corrected for the Galactic extinction
due to the reddening of E(B-V) = 0.017 in the direction of the burst
(Schlegel et al. 1998).
